Commit History

Autor SHA1 Mensaxe Data
  greatbridf 2392ac19d2 style: reformat the files related to next patches hai 2 semanas
  greatbridf 913f71f819 mem: introduce new `Folio` abstraction hai 2 semanas
  greatbridf 45268e7d33 vfs: rework of inode and page cache system hai 3 semanas
  greatbridf 661a15940b riscv64, trap: rework to fix nested captured traps hai 6 meses
  greatbridf b321265202 mm, arch: refine page cache impl and count cpu on la64 hai 6 meses
  Heinz 2d61f60c0c syscall: more new syscall impls hai 7 meses
  greatbridf 5c9d03601a style(riscv64): remove stale TODO message hai 6 meses
  Heinz 21f6feb418 change(hal): change ap's temporary boot stack to only one stack hai 7 meses
  greatbridf 66f509c5d6 change(smp): use FDT.harts() in riscv64 bootstrap_smp hai 7 meses
  greatbridf 80731802bd fix(ap_start): replace mul with left shifts in riscv64 ap entry hai 7 meses
  Heinz 792633d3e8 style(hal): remove unused import and unused function hai 7 meses
  Heinz 2a25dbda3b feat(hal): improve riscv64 smp, get ap start addr from label hai 7 meses
  Heinz 0359279932 feat(hal): impl smp bootstrap for riscv64 hai 7 meses
  greatbridf dad0fa00ef feat(interrupt): add external interrupt support for riscv64 hai 7 meses
  Heinz f7d4f9d574 style(hal): remove unused import and modify annotation hai 7 meses
  Heinz 7280c46efb feat(hal): add timer interrupt enable hai 7 meses
  greatbridf 2d868ba813 partial work: working trap hai 7 meses
  greatbridf bb2b276c8e partial work: impl virtio block device and sbi console hai 7 meses
  greatbridf 4351cf5573 partial work: fix riscv64 bootstrap hai 7 meses
  Heinz 0c6a045342 change link.x.in and disable some function for debug hai 8 meses
  Heinz 191877a3ac feat(hal): impl basic single hart bootstrap for riscv64 hai 8 meses